CSM vs PSM vs SAFe SSM: Choosing the Right Agile Certification

Agile Certification webinar announcement with expert.

Understanding Agile Frameworks: CSM, PSM, and SAFe

In the world of agile methodologies, clarity on certifications is crucial for team leaders and aspiring project managers. The Certified Scrum Master (CSM), Professional Scrum Master (PSM), and SAFe Scrum Master (SSM) represent significant paths within this realm. Each certification caters to different project environments and roles, making understanding these options essential for professional growth.

The CSM Certification: Foundations of Scrum

The CSM is an entry-level certification that introduces the fundamentals of the Scrum framework. It prepares participants to understand Scrum roles, ceremonies, and artifacts, establishing a solid foundation for applying agile practices in various scenarios. Being a CSM also emphasizes the importance of collaboration and maintaining a productive team atmosphere.

PSM Certification: Advanced Scrum Knowledge

The PSM, on the other hand, delves deeper into Scrum principles and practices, equipping learners with a rigorous understanding of the framework. This certification is often preferred by those looking for a stronger grasp of agile philosophies and can be pursued without attending a course. It allows professionals to showcase their commitment to mastering Scrum.

SAFe SSM: Scaling Agile Across the Organization

For larger organizations, the SAFe SSM offers a broader perspective by integrating Scrum within the Scaled Agile Framework. This certification is tailored for Scrum Masters working in complex environments where multiple teams need to collaborate effectively. The SAFe SSM focuses on how to align agile teams with broader organizational goals, ensuring everyone contributes to shared success.

Deciding What's Best for You

The best certification for you ultimately depends on your career goals and the specific contexts in which you aim to apply agile principles. If you're just starting, the CSM may be your ideal entry point. If you're ready to deepen your expertise, consider PSM. If you're interested in leading agile transformations in larger enterprises, the SAFe SSM could be the best fit.

Unlocking Business Insights: How Game Theory Enhances Agile Project Management

Update Understanding Game Theory in Management Game theory, a mathematical framework for analyzing strategic interactions, plays a vital role in management, influencing decisions within organizations. Simply put, it is the study of how individuals or groups make choices that impact one another. Today, businesses recognize game theory as a valuable tool for navigating complex scenarios where competition and cooperation collide. The Importance of Strategic Decision-Making Imagine leading a team where the choices of each member affect the overall outcome. In management, this is a daily reality. Game theory encourages leaders to consider the actions and reactions of others when making decisions, ensuring a more strategic approach to problem-solving. By applying this concept, managers can foster a collaborative environment while effectively addressing competitive threats. Applications of Game Theory in Agile Project Management Within agile project management, game theory can enhance team dynamics and efficiency. Agile methodologies prioritize adaptability, and understanding game theory can provide insights on how best to approach team negotiations and stakeholder relations. For instance, during sprint planning, project managers can foresee potential conflicts and devise strategies to mitigate risks by aligning team goals with organizational objectives. Parallel Examples: Real-World Applications Real-world companies like Google and Amazon leverage game theory in their strategies. Google, for example, analyzes competitor behavior when launching new products. They use this understanding to predict market responses and position their offerings effectively. Similarly, Amazon uses game theory to refine its customer loyalty programs, ensuring that strategies foster long-term engagement. Future Insights: Evolving Management Strategies As the business landscape continues to evolve, the principles of game theory may further influence management practices. Organizations might adopt more advanced simulations to analyze potential market strategies, creating more robust models for predicting outcomes. In the future, leaders who harness game theory will likely outperform those who neglect it, making it an essential focus for upcoming training and development programs. Decisions You Can Make with Game Theory Understanding game theory allows decision-makers to evaluate risks and opportunities with greater clarity. It equips them to handle various scenarios, foresee potential complications, and plan accordingly. By weighing the payoffs of different strategies, managers can make informed choices that align with both team and organizational goals, ultimately driving success. Common Misconceptions and Myths about Game Theory While many believe that game theory is solely about competition, it also emphasizes cooperation. A common myth is that it applies only to economics or finance; however, its principles are intrinsic to human behavior and management practices. By recognizing the full scope of game theory, managers can better apply its concepts across various sectors. How Game Theory Shapes Team Interactions Applying game theory to team interactions can lead to more productive collaboration. When team members understand their interdependencies, they become more inclined to cooperate rather than compete. This shift in mindset encourages a healthier workplace culture and fosters innovation, as employees feel safe sharing ideas and feedback. In conclusion, understanding game theory provides significant advantages for CIOs, HR leaders, and business process managers alike. By appreciating its principles, professionals can refine their decision-making processes and enhance team dynamics, ultimately boosting organizational performance. As you explore the implications of game theory, consider applying these insights to your management strategy today for better alignment with your agile project management objectives.
